Description

Colored view of the Quarantine Harbour in Malta, with a steamship, moored gondolas, and a church with a bell tower in the background. The back indicates the publisher 'Raphael Tuck & Sons', a British 2d stamp, and a postmark 'Malta' dated June 16, 1906. The handwritten address is intended for Mr. Léon Carrière in Calais.
